Frequently Asked Questions About Neutrality Studies

What is Neutrality Studies about and what kind of topics does it cover?

The show centers on geopolitics, neutrality, and critical perspectives on Western foreign policy, with a focus on Iran, the Middle East, and global power dynamics. Episodes frequently feature in-depth analyses from academics, former military officers, and geopolitical commentators, often challenging mainstream narratives and exploring energy security, sanctions, and international law. Listeners can expect rigorous, multi-angled discussions that blend historical context with current events, sometimes featuring provocative takes on Western policy and media framing.
